Reference documentation for deal.II version 8.4.2
parallel::distributed::BlockVector< Number > Member List

This is the complete list of members for parallel::distributed::BlockVector< Number >, including all inherited members.

add(const std::vector< size_type > &indices, const std::vector< Number > &values)BlockVectorBase< Vector< Number > >
add(const std::vector< size_type > &indices, const Vector< Number > &values)BlockVectorBase< Vector< Number > >
add(const size_type n_elements, const size_type *indices, const Number *values)BlockVectorBase< Vector< Number > >
add(const value_type s)BlockVectorBase< Vector< Number > >
add(const BlockVectorBase &V) DEAL_II_DEPRECATEDBlockVectorBase< Vector< Number > >
add(const value_type a, const BlockVectorBase &V)BlockVectorBase< Vector< Number > >
add(const value_type a, const BlockVectorBase &V, const value_type b, const BlockVectorBase &W)BlockVectorBase< Vector< Number > >
add_and_dot(const Number a, const BlockVector< Number > &V, const BlockVector< Number > &W)parallel::distributed::BlockVector< Number >
BlockVectorBase< Vector< Number > >::add_and_dot(const value_type a, const BlockVectorBase &V, const BlockVectorBase &W)BlockVectorBase< Vector< Number > >
all_zero() constparallel::distributed::BlockVector< Number >
BaseClass typedefparallel::distributed::BlockVector< Number >
begin()BlockVectorBase< Vector< Number > >
begin() constBlockVectorBase< Vector< Number > >
block(const unsigned int i)BlockVectorBase< Vector< Number > >
block(const unsigned int i) constBlockVectorBase< Vector< Number > >
block_indicesBlockVectorBase< Vector< Number > >protected
BlockType typedefparallel::distributed::BlockVector< Number >
BlockVector(const size_type num_blocks=0, const size_type block_size=0)parallel::distributed::BlockVector< Number >explicit
BlockVector(const BlockVector< Number > &V)parallel::distributed::BlockVector< Number >
BlockVector(const BlockVector< OtherNumber > &v)parallel::distributed::BlockVector< Number >explicit
BlockVector(const std::vector< size_type > &block_sizes)parallel::distributed::BlockVector< Number >
BlockVector(const std::vector< IndexSet > &local_ranges, const std::vector< IndexSet > &ghost_indices, const MPI_Comm communicator)parallel::distributed::BlockVector< Number >
BlockVector(const std::vector< IndexSet > &local_ranges, const MPI_Comm communicator)parallel::distributed::BlockVector< Number >
BlockVectorBase()BlockVectorBase< Vector< Number > >
collect_sizes()BlockVectorBase< Vector< Number > >
componentsBlockVectorBase< Vector< Number > >protected
compress(::VectorOperation::values operation)parallel::distributed::BlockVector< Number >
DeclException0(ExcIteratorRangeDoesNotMatchVectorSize)parallel::distributed::BlockVector< Number >
DeclException2(ExcNoSubscriber, char *, char *,<< "No subscriber with identifier <"<< arg2<< "> subscribes to this object of class "<< arg1<< ". Consequently, it cannot be unsubscribed.")Subscriptor
DeclException3(ExcInUse, int, char *, std::string &,<< "Object of class "<< arg2<< " is still used by "<< arg1<< " other objects."<< "\"<< "(Additional information: "<< arg3<< ")\"<< "See the entry in the Frequently Asked Questions of "<< "deal.II (linked to from http://www.dealii.org/) for "<< "a lot more information on what this error means and "<< "how to fix programs in which it happens.")Subscriptor
end()BlockVectorBase< Vector< Number > >
end() constBlockVectorBase< Vector< Number > >
equ(const value_type a, const BlockVector2 &V)BlockVectorBase< Vector< Number > >
equ(const value_type a, const BlockVectorBase &V, const value_type b, const BlockVectorBase &W)BlockVectorBase< Vector< Number > >
extract_subvector_to(const std::vector< size_type > &indices, std::vector< OtherNumber > &values) constBlockVectorBase< Vector< Number > >
extract_subvector_to(ForwardIterator indices_begin, const ForwardIterator indices_end, OutputIterator values_begin) constBlockVectorBase< Vector< Number > >
get_block_indices() constBlockVectorBase< Vector< Number > >
has_ghost_elements() constparallel::distributed::BlockVector< Number >
in_local_range(const size_type global_index) constBlockVectorBase< Vector< Number > >
is_non_negative() constparallel::distributed::BlockVector< Number >
l1_norm() constparallel::distributed::BlockVector< Number >
l2_norm() constparallel::distributed::BlockVector< Number >
linfty_norm() constparallel::distributed::BlockVector< Number >
list_subscribers() constSubscriptor
locally_owned_elements() constBlockVectorBase< Vector< Number > >
lp_norm(const real_type p) constparallel::distributed::BlockVector< Number >
mean_value() constparallel::distributed::BlockVector< Number >
memory_consumption() constBlockVectorBase< Vector< Number > >
n_blocks() constBlockVectorBase< Vector< Number > >
n_subscriptions() constSubscriptor
norm_sqr() constparallel::distributed::BlockVector< Number >
operator!=(const BlockVector< Number2 > &v) constparallel::distributed::BlockVector< Number >
operator()(const size_type i) constBlockVectorBase< Vector< Number > >
operator()(const size_type i)BlockVectorBase< Vector< Number > >
operator*(const BlockVector< Number2 > &V) constparallel::distributed::BlockVector< Number >
BlockVectorBase< Vector< Number > >::operator*(const BlockVectorBase &V) constBlockVectorBase< Vector< Number > >
operator*=(const value_type factor)BlockVectorBase< Vector< Number > >
operator+=(const BlockVectorBase &V)BlockVectorBase< Vector< Number > >
operator-=(const BlockVectorBase &V)BlockVectorBase< Vector< Number > >
operator/=(const value_type factor)BlockVectorBase< Vector< Number > >
operator=(const value_type s)parallel::distributed::BlockVector< Number >
operator=(const BlockVector &V)parallel::distributed::BlockVector< Number >
operator=(const BlockVector< Number2 > &V)parallel::distributed::BlockVector< Number >
operator=(const Vector< Number > &V)parallel::distributed::BlockVector< Number >
operator=(const PETScWrappers::MPI::BlockVector &petsc_vec)parallel::distributed::BlockVector< Number >
operator=(const TrilinosWrappers::MPI::BlockVector &trilinos_vec)parallel::distributed::BlockVector< Number >
BlockVectorBase< Vector< Number > >::operator=(const BlockVectorBase &V)BlockVectorBase< Vector< Number > >
BlockVectorBase< Vector< Number > >::operator=(const BlockVectorBase< VectorType2 > &V)BlockVectorBase< Vector< Number > >
Subscriptor::operator=(const Subscriptor &)Subscriptor
operator==(const BlockVector< Number2 > &v) constparallel::distributed::BlockVector< Number >
BlockVectorBase< Vector< Number > >::operator==(const BlockVectorBase< VectorType2 > &v) constBlockVectorBase< Vector< Number > >
operator[](const size_type i) constBlockVectorBase< Vector< Number > >
operator[](const size_type i)BlockVectorBase< Vector< Number > >
reinit(const size_type num_blocks, const size_type block_size=0, const bool omit_zeroing_entries=false)parallel::distributed::BlockVector< Number >
reinit(const std::vector< size_type > &N, const bool omit_zeroing_entries=false)parallel::distributed::BlockVector< Number >
reinit(const BlockVector< Number2 > &V, const bool omit_zeroing_entries=false)parallel::distributed::BlockVector< Number >
sadd(const value_type s, const BlockVectorBase &V)BlockVectorBase< Vector< Number > >
sadd(const value_type s, const value_type a, const BlockVectorBase &V)BlockVectorBase< Vector< Number > >
sadd(const value_type s, const value_type a, const BlockVectorBase &V, const value_type b, const BlockVectorBase &W)BlockVectorBase< Vector< Number > >
sadd(const value_type s, const value_type a, const BlockVectorBase &V, const value_type b, const BlockVectorBase &W, const value_type c, const BlockVectorBase &X)BlockVectorBase< Vector< Number > >
scale(const BlockVector2 &v)parallel::distributed::BlockVector< Number >
serialize(Archive &ar, const unsigned int version)Subscriptorinline
size() constBlockVectorBase< Vector< Number > >
subscribe(const char *identifier=0) constSubscriptor
Subscriptor()Subscriptor
Subscriptor(const Subscriptor &)Subscriptor
supports_distributed_dataBlockVectorBase< Vector< Number > >static
swap(BlockVector< Number > &v)parallel::distributed::BlockVector< Number >
unsubscribe(const char *identifier=0) constSubscriptor
update_ghost_values() constparallel::distributed::BlockVector< Number >
value_type typedefparallel::distributed::BlockVector< Number >
zero_out_ghosts()parallel::distributed::BlockVector< Number >
~BlockVector()parallel::distributed::BlockVector< Number >
~Subscriptor()Subscriptorvirtual